Debt relief programs take time, and it’s important to have patience to stay the course. It can take anywhere from two to four years for the entire process.
Debt relief programs can take from 2 to 4 years to complete and it is common for your credit score to suffer as you negotiate your debt. Once your debt is settled, your credit score should recover.
